 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service

Protecting Medicare Beneficiaries' Informed Choice Act of 2005 - Amends title XVIII (Medicare) of the Social Security Act to extend the annual enrollment periods of the Medicare prescription drug benefit program and under the Medicare Advantage program.

Suspends Medicare prescription drug late enrollment penalties for two years after the initial enrollment period.
